Founded in 1989, Stokenham Short Mat Bowling Club soon gathered an enthusiastic following and centred on Stokenham Parish Hall, it was not long before there were sufficient members to acquire two playing mats and all  the necessary support equipment.  Some attention to the floor and subsequent improvements to the lighting has resulted in excellent playing conditions. Not always to the club's advantage as visiting teams soon adapt to our home conditions.
 
 Today the club has a membership of 42 the majority of whom are keen active bowlers with sufficient enthusiasm to enable the fielding of two teams in the local league in addition to playing a number of friendly matches, knock out competitions and the arranging of numerous club competitions.
 Keen competition in a friendly sociable atmosphere has continued to be one of the main objectives of the club and the purely social side is not neglected with the Annual Dinner and
Lavis Cup Party as well as other fun events.

In 1999 to celebrate its anniversary, the club produced a brief history of the first ten years wherein it stated that of the original membership 18 were still with the club, today 12 remain although one or two are much longer in the tooth and there is a growing need to recruit some of the younger generations. 2008 will see the beginning of the club's 20th year and thoughts are already turning towards suitable ways to celebrate the 20th anniversary.
